18 Facts About Tony Philliskirk

1.

Anthony Philliskirk was born on 10 February 1965 and is an English former footballer.

2.

Tony Philliskirk played as a striker for 11 different clubs between 1983 and 1998.

3.

Tony Philliskirk turned professional at the age of 18, when he joined Sheffield United.

4.

Tony Philliskirk made his debut for the Blades in a pre-season friendly against Mansfield Town at Field Mill on 17 August 1983.

5.

Tony Philliskirk had to wait until 18 October 1983, before making his league debut for Sheffield United against Brentford at Griffin Park.

6.

Tony Philliskirk scored his first goal for the club two weeks later at Plymouth Argyle.

7.

Tony Philliskirk scored eight goals in his first season with Sheffield United.

8.

Tony Philliskirk made his debut for Bolton on 19 August 1989 in a Third Division match against Cardiff City at Ninian Park, and he soon formed an effective striking partnership with David Reeves.

9.

Tony Philliskirk moved on to Peterborough United in October 1992, and then had spells with Burnley, Cardiff City, Halifax Town and Macclesfield Town before hanging up his boots in 1998.

10.

Tony Philliskirk spent a couple of years as a referee towards the end of his playing days.

11.

Tony Philliskirk was one of 15 players who accepted a training offer in 1996 as part of a PFA scheme to encourage more former professionals to take up the whistle.

12.

Tony Philliskirk progressed as far as the Northern Premier League.

13.

Tony Philliskirk became assistant manager at Oldham Athletic until December 2003, when his team manager Iain Dowie was tempted away by Crystal Palace.

14.

Dowie wanted to take his assistant with him, but Tony Philliskirk turned down the offer for personal reasons.

15.

Tony Philliskirk stayed at Boundary Park, where he is Oldham's youth coach, a role he initially filled for four years before becoming Dowie's assistant in 2002.

16.

Tony Philliskirk was suspended from his role as academy manager in April 2018.

17.

In December 2018, Tony Philliskirk returned to Burnley FC where we had a short spell as player in the 1990s and was appointed the new head coach of the U18s team.

18.

Tony Philliskirk's son Danny is a professional footballer, who plays for AFC Fylde, after previously playing for Sheffield United, Blackpool, and Oldham Athletic his father's former clubs.
